Law banning smoking in public places in practice

This news has been read 11867 times!

KUWAIT CITY, July 24: Minister of Justice and State Minister for National Assembly Affairs Dr Faleh Al-Azab has activated the law banning smoking in closed and public places, while unveiling his intention to ask the help of the Environment Police Unit in conducting anti-smoking campaigns in courts and various departments of the ministry, reports Al-Rai daily.

He revealed the law stipulates penalties and fines, adding that the ministry will assign teams in its sections and departments to take action against those who will be proven to have violated the law. He also affirmed that smoking areas will be specified prior to the implementation of the law.

It is worth mentioning that the Environment Police Unit, which is under the Public Security Department in the Interior Ministry, recently launched a number of information campaigns to raise awareness among citizens and expatriates about Environment Protection Law number 42/2014 and the amended version – law number 99/2015 which prohibits smoking in public and closed places.

Syrian kidnapped: Police are looking for three Syrians who allegedly kidnapped a compatriot and forced him to sign on blank promissory notes, reports Al-Rai daily.

The victim informed securitymen from Nugra Police Station that three unknown Syrians bundled him into their car, drove him to an open ground where they fiercely assaulted him, took him to an apartment and forced him to sign on six blank promissory notes.

Egyptian stabbed: Some unknown individuals broke into the house of an Egyptian man in Jleeb Al-Shuyoukh area and stabbed him several times, reports Al-Anba daily.

The victim has been referred to Farwaniya hospital where he has been admitted in the Intensive Care Unit as he had sustained several serious injuries.

Meanwhile, officers from Residency Investigations Department arrested 16 housemaids and two expatriates and referred them to the deportation center because they violated residency and labor laws, reports Al-Anba daily.

One of the arrested expatriates used to offer domestic labor services on hourly basis via social media, specifically Facebook. He used to hire absconding housemaids for the purpose.

After he was arrested, he led securitymen to the housemaids working under him.

The other expatriate was arrested for illegally running an office for employing absconding housemaids.

Gamblers quarrel: An Asian expatriate was arrested for quarreling with five compatriots during a gambling session inside a commercial complex in Al-Mirqab area, reports Al-Rai daily

According to police report, the gamblers were sitting on the floor inside the commercial complex and gambling. After about one hour and 30 minutes, the suspects started fighting and hitting each other.

When the Operations Room of Ministry of Interior received information about the incident from bystanders, Capital securitymen rushed to the location and arrested one of the suspects, while the rest escaped.

When questioned, he revealed the identity of the rest of the suspects.

Search is ongoing to find and arrest the remaining suspects.
